The name Jrake has seen a varied level of popularity over the past fifteen years in the United States, with fluctuations in the number of births each year.
In 2008, there were 5 newborns named Jrake. This number increased to 10 in both 2009 and 2010, indicating that the name was beginning to gain some traction during this time period. The popularity of the name peaked in 2011 with 17 births, suggesting that it was at its most popular that year.
However, after 2011, the number of newborns named Jrake began to decrease. There were 12 births in 2012 and 9 births in 2013, indicating a decline in popularity over these two years. The name's popularity seemed to stabilize between 5 and 9 births per year from 2016 to 2020.
Interestingly, there was a slight increase in the number of newborns named Jrake in recent years, with 9 births each in both 2019 and 2020. This trend continued into 2021 and 2022, with 6 births each year, before jumping back up to 11 births in 2023.
In total, there have been 123 newborns named Jrake in the United States between 2008 and 2023. While the name's popularity has varied over this time period, it has remained a relatively uncommon choice compared to more traditional names.
